And again we’re continuing with our this week in fake devices series. Here’s what we’ve prepared for you today:

  • Nokia E76 dual slider ripoff – E76? dual-slider? C’mon, only few NSeries devices come with that.
  • Vertu Jaguar ripoff – it’s not a first fake Jaguar phone we’ve seen, but the first one which is also a Vertu device. Looks like the Nokia 8800 to me.
  • Sony Ericsson W705 clone – keys look pretty much identical, but the big “Bluetooth” sign clearly points it’s a fake phone.
  • Diamond Nokia E71 clone – actually it’s NCKIA not NOKIA, and its keys are somewhat different from the original device. Heck, you can even say it looks more like the E55 than E71.
  • Sony Ericsson VAIO ripoff – all-touchscreen clone which made me thinking – yap I want the VAIO phone (but the real deal, of course). That would be awesome.
